What is the Role of an Air Purifier in Managing Household Dust?
Air purifiers are devices designed to remove airborne particles, such as dust, from indoor environments. They work by drawing in air, filtering it through various media, and releasing purified air back into the room.
According to the U.S. Environmental Protection Agency (EPA), air purifiers can significantly reduce the levels of indoor pollutants, including dust and allergens, thereby improving overall air quality.
Air purifiers utilize different filtration systems, including HEPA filters, activated carbon filters, and pre-filters. HEPA filters capture particles as small as 0.3 microns, making them effective against dust, pollen, and pet dander. Activated carbon filters absorb odors and chemical vapors, further enhancing air quality.
The American Lung Association defines indoor dust as a mixture of various materials, including skin flakes, fibers, and bits of dirt. Common sources include furniture, textiles, and outdoor elements entering the home.
Household dust can accumulate rapidly, with studies indicating that homes can gather over 10 grams of dust per week. This dust can contain harmful substances, including allergens, and exposure can lead to health problems such as asthma and other respiratory issues.
Dust exposure is linked to increased allergies and respiratory diseases, impacting millions. Furthermore, unhealthy indoor air quality contributes to decreased productivity and affects children’s cognitive development.
Implementing air purifiers can counteract dust buildup. The EPA recommends using HEPA filters for effective dust removal. Regular cleaning practices, such as vacuuming with HEPA-equipped vacuums, also aid in minimizing dust accumulation.
Utilizing a multi-faceted approach, including good ventilation and moisture control, can further reduce dust levels in homes. Continuous air quality monitoring helps maintain optimal conditions for improved health and comfort.
How Do HEPA Filters Effectively Capture Dust Particles?
HEPA filters effectively capture dust particles by using a dense mat of fibers that create a barrier, trapping particles during air filtration. These filters have specific features that enhance their dust-catching abilities:
-
Filtration mechanism: HEPA stands for High-Efficiency Particulate Air. These filters are designed to capture at least 99.97% of particles as small as 0.3 microns in diameter. This size is significant because many common allergens and dust particles fall within this range.
-
Fiber structure: The fibers in HEPA filters are arranged in a random pattern. This arrangement increases the likelihood of particles colliding with the fibers as air flows through, which enhances their trapping capability.
-
Particle interception: As air moves through the HEPA filter, particles are entrapped in three main ways:
1. Interception: Particles that come close to the fibers stick to them due to van der Waals forces.
2. Inertial impaction: Larger particles cannot follow the bending paths of the air stream and collide with the fibers.
3. Diffusion: Smaller particles move erratically and may hit fibers due to Brownian motion, allowing them to be captured. -
Airflow resistance: HEPA filters create a certain level of resistance to airflow. This characteristic encourages air to pass through the filter, maximizing contact time between particles and fiber surfaces and improving filtration efficiency.
Studies, such as those by the American Society of Heating, Refrigerating and Air-Conditioning Engineers in 2017, have confirmed that HEPA filtration systems significantly reduce airborne dust and allergens in both residential and commercial settings, contributing to improved indoor air quality.
Overall, the design and construction of HEPA filters play a crucial role in effectively capturing dust particles.

Ionic Air Purifiers:
Ionic air purifiers release negatively charged ions into the air. These ions attach to dust and other particles, causing them to clump together and fall from the air. Studies suggest that ionic purifiers can reduce airborne particulate matter; however, they may produce ozone as a byproduct, which can be harmful. According to the EPA, ozone can exacerbate respiratory issues. Consumers should be cautious and look for models that keep ozone levels within safe limits.
